As a result of the seven years war, how far west did british territory exist?
tiny-mole [99]
Following the Seven Years War, the British Empire was able to secure all territories from the Atlantic coast to the Mississippi River. This was a great achievement for the Britsih Empire who now controlled larger portions of the continent at the cost of a French presence in North America. However, the presence of the English was not challenged, as a result of the Seven Years War, the Spanish also amassed vast territories on the continent.

Who<br> were the first settler's in Jamestown
Ivan

Answer: In 1607, 104 English men and boys arrived in North America to start a settlement. On May 13 they picked Jamestown, Virginia for their settlement, which was named after their King, James I. The settlement became the first permanent English settlement in North America
